Customers no longer base their loyalty on price or product. Instead, they stay
loyal with companies due to the experience they receive. In fact, 86% of buyers
are willing to pay more for a great customer experience.
CEM uses experiential data to deliver on the things that matter most to
customers. When customer’s expectations are met, or better yet
exceeded by a company, the experience is optimized.
CEM software:
Stores data in a way that is secure and easily navigated by your team.
In essence, both aim to make the interaction between the customer and the
vendor as smooth and enjoyable as possible. A CRM system focuses on
managing the process from the employee’s perspective and a CEM manages
the customer’s side. The combination are both necessary for delivering
awesome experiences.
Integrating the brand view of customers (CRM) with customer view of brand
(CEM) creates a more holistic understanding of a company’s strengths and
performance.
